As February 2026 wraps up, Greenlawn, NY continues to prove its resilience and momentum in the real estate sector. Buyers and sellers alike are experiencing results shaped by limited inventory and rapid closings, prompting many to wonder what opportunities remain in the weeks ahead.

Median sold price has stayed at $915,000—a dramatic 28 percent month-over-month gain—while the median days on market for closed listings remains quick at 21. Only three active homes and 0.42 months of supply underline the competitive nature of the landscape. Why it matters: Both affordable homes in Greenlawn, NY this February 2026 and higher-end properties attract attention; timing and preparation are essential for success as we finish out the month.

February’s Benchmarks and Trends

Ten closed transactions in three months total $9,172,000, with sellers regularly achieving 103 percent of asking price or more. Is it a good time to buy in Greenlawn, NY? Market figures indicate that targeted planning and adaptability give buyers an edge during the final weeks.

  • Median sold price: $915,000
  • Median days on market: 21
  • Inventory: 3 homes
